GUNN BALDURSSON
MEMORIAL AWARD / (Championship MVP)
The Gunn Baldursson Award is awarded to the Most Valuable Player
of the National Championship. The selection is made by a committee
established by the Host. The trophy was donated by Acadia University
and the Baldursson family in memory of Gunnhildur Baldursson. A
native of Iceland, "The Gunner" was a two-time All Conference
soccer player for the Acadia University Women's Soccer Team, and
a National Team member. Baldursson was killed in a tragic car accident
in 1987.

CHANTAL NAVERT
MEMORIAL AWARD (Player of the Year)
The Chantal Navert Memorial Award is presented annually to the Outstanding
Player of the Year. The award was donated by the Université
de Sherbrooke in memory of Chantal Navert. Chantal, a National Soccer
Official for 15 years, an avid university soccer supporter and a
role model for those aspiring to become referees at the National
and International level, passed away suddenly in 1995. The winner
is selected by a selection committee composed of members of the
CIS Coaches Association.

ROOKIE OF THE
YEAR
Initiated in 1996, the Rookie of the Year Award is presented annually
to a first-year player in CIS soccer who has exhibited exemplary
skill and leadership. The winner is selected by the CIS Coaches
Association.
